- Description
- A bag of plastic curtain rings from Rock Rest Tourist Home. Inside the clear bag are fourteen (14) solid white plastic rings. The bag holding the rings are sealed at the top with a textured white label. The white label has red bands across the top and bottom and blue text across the center that reads, [NUMBER / 3534P Kencrest PRICE / 19¢] at the top and [14 PLASTIC CURTAIN RINGS / 5/8 / INCH] on the bottom. The back is identical to the front.
